Dowie clinches two more signings

July 11 2004

Crystal Palace

Crystal Palace

Palace have signed goalkeeper Julian Speroni and defender Emmerson Boyce.

Both players put pen to paper in the last 48 hours and becoming Dowie's second and third signings of the close season.

Speroni has joined Palace from cash-strapped Dundee for £500,000. The 25-year-old Argentinian is hoping that his move to Palace will lead to a call-up for his country in the forthcoming World Cup qualifiers.

Boyce is a right-sided defender, who was Luton Town's player of the season last term. He has joined Palace on a Bosman free after impressing during a trial.

Both players, together with other new signing Mark Hudson will travel with the rest of the squad next week for the first two pre-season matches in Northern Ireland.
